Enermax shows 650W fanless PSU at CeBIT

by Hilbert Hagedoorn on: 03/07/2013 08:25 AM | source: | 0 comment(s)
Enermax shows 650W fanless PSU at CeBIT

Enermax presented a passively cooled 650W power supply at CeBIT. The unit is 80Plus Platinum certified and has 100% modular cabling, dynamic hybrid topology, and DC-to-DC switching. They where still showing prototypes though and availability won't be any sooner then perhaps Q3 of this year. Photo's after the break.

But they certainly look great, have good Wattage and well ... 100% silence. Nice.
